Output fffbba005ab393de383f821eb9e1bba7ec43f9dacafc72f65af78f0e2aa8a954:0

value
102039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e807c609d070b0508e85f05d65aca1762b9ce9e OP_EQUAL
address
3QthUd2dP8248JHCzK9cqjLjDqzC3LPQMq
transaction
fffbba005ab393de383f821eb9e1bba7ec43f9dacafc72f65af78f0e2aa8a954
spent
true